Synthesis, Assembly and Characterization of Nanoparticle Composite CdS/TAB

Abstract: The nanoparticle composite CdS/TAB(dimethyldioctadecyl ammonium) is synthesized. It is investigated by IRspectroscopy, UV spectroscopy, X-ray diffraction, TEM, AFM and SPS, which prove the existence of CdSnanocrystal and the formation of core shell structure. Also, the size of the composite can be controlled by altering the ratio.In the meantime, it is indicated by EFM that such orderly assembly substance can form electrostatic field superlattice.

Key words: CdS nanoparticles, Structure of core-shell, Electrostatic Field superlattice
